Skin Prep Recommendations for a More Even Result
Before a session, expert prep is essential. Professionals typically advise gentle exfoliation in the days leading up to your appointment, focusing on areas that collect dry skin like elbows, knees, and ankles. Hydration matters, but heavy oils can interfere with adhesion, so lightweight, non-greasy moisturizers are often preferred. Many specialists also recommend avoiding deodorant, lotions, and makeup right before the appointment to reduce streaking risk. Wearing loose clothing afterward and giving the solution adequate time to develop will support a smooth, natural-looking finish.
How to Choose the Right Shade and Technique
Color selection is where expert recommendation really shows. A skilled technician will assess your undertone—cool, warm, or neutral—and recommend a shade that complements it. They may suggest adjusting intensity based on your natural coloring and desired outcome, from barely-there radiance to a more noticeable bronzed look. Technique matters too: proper equipment settings, consistent application patterns, and attention to detail around joints and hairline areas contribute to a uniform appearance. If you have sensitive skin, ask about formulation options and patch testing practices so your results are both beautiful and comfortable.
